Output fec68bc85e56d3a009f4d047be390a21a1f8b60c4cc6ea4731fe2dfaf30cd6a0:0

value
27000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18af91f75c24b1de84118c0962e4399ffbf8cde5 OP_EQUAL
address
33wYTyfDvJfCVGiwawJ96zUFLn6ypg1fHW
transaction
fec68bc85e56d3a009f4d047be390a21a1f8b60c4cc6ea4731fe2dfaf30cd6a0
confirmations
2607
spent
true